B97 4DL is an up-and-coming urban area on Prospect Hill, 0.3km from Redditch in Redditch. Administratively it sits within Abbey ward and the Redditch constituency.

This is a strong family neighbourhood — a culturally diverse area with a strong community identity. Work and footfall patterns mark this as a public administration and security zone — public administration and security with mainly white workforces. This is a stable, socially diverse area (average age 38) — accessible for a wide range of households, from young families to empty nesters. 74% of properties are owner-occupied — a strong indicator of neighbourhood stability and long-term community investment. The area has a notably diverse population — 34% of residents identify as non-white, reflecting the multicultural character of this part of Redditch.

Safety: Crime rates are high (232 per 1,000 residents) — commercial zones and transport hubs in the vicinity contribute to these figures.

Census 2021 statistics for B97 4DL are sourced from Output Area E00164388 (shared with 13 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
